Spinach Cottage Cheese Flagels

These Irresistibly Easy Spinach Cottage Cheese Flagels are a healthy, comforting, and versatile meal option, perfect for any time of the day.

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Course Breakfast, Brunch, Snack
Cuisine American, Healthy
Servings 8 flagels
Calories 120 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 1 cup Cottage Cheese Full-fat recommended for richness.
  • 2 tablespoons Olive Oil Can be replaced with avocado oil.
  • 1 large Egg For binding; can substitute with ground flaxseed for vegan option.
  • 1 cup All-Purpose Flour Gluten-free option: use almond flour.
  • 1 teaspoon Baking Powder Ensure it is fresh.
  • 1 teaspoon Salt Sea salt recommended.
  • 2 cups Baby Spinach Finely chopped; can substitute with other leafy greens.
  • 1 cup Shredded Mozzarella Cheese Feta can be used for additional flavor.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• In a bowl, combine the cottage cheese, olive oil, and egg (or flaxseed mixture).
  • In another b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t.
  • Slowly add the dry ingredients into the wet mix while stirring gently.
  • Fold in the finely chopped spinach and mozzarella.
  • Shape the dough into bagel-like shapes, about an inch thick.
  • Place on a lined baking sheet and bake for 20-25 minutes until golden brown.
  • Allow to cool on a wire rack before serving.

Notes

These flagels are perfect for meal prep and can be stored in an airtight container for up to four days. They freeze well, and you can create different flavor profiles by adding herbs or spices.
